BIO:

Hi I’m Muschu!  I am one gorgeous handsome catch for sure. I love to be petted,  lay on my back for belly rubs and be brushed.  I have these adorable little golden tufts of fur by all my feet and sometimes it tickles when my foster mom brushes them.  Even though I am 10, you wouldn’t even know it-  I don’t have a single spot of gray and I’ve got a cute little spring in my step. I had my teeth cleaned and they took out a few and WOW do I feel better now! I like being a dog, I get to lie in the sun, sleep in the big bed when I want to go for walks and just be loved on.

Muschu has come a long way.  He was a former breeder dog and very shy when he first came to rescue.  He hid behind the couch for the first 3 days and seemed very frightened.  When he finally did come out he was pretty confused.  There is a doggy ramp from the patio to the back yard and he was afraid of it- so I carried him down to the yard to do his business and then he would scamper back up. After a few days he finally got the hang of it and started going down the ramp by himself.

Another thing was playtime- Muschu didn’t play at all. He would just lay on his pillow and watch. Then one day after a few weeks -  he started playing with the other dogs-  it was so cute and such a wonderful breakthrough. He later went out on the patio and started palying woth a small stuffed Snoopy toy. Now he likes little fuzzy toys and the nylabone as well. Muschu is still very quiet-  he will only bark if there really is a reason to. He is housetrained on a schedule and no trouble at all.  When we leave he goes right in his crate without a fuss and you never hear a peep out of him. Muschu would love to have a home where he can be pet and loved for hours on end as well as a fenced yard for him to explore and just be a dog. Is that your home?

AADR does not recommend dachshunds for families with children under 5, or families planning to have children during the dog's lifetime. Dachshunds are often not patient with little kids, and kids can accidentally hurt a dachshund's back or get bitten.
